Product DescriptionHave you ever walked down the wrong road hoping to get to the right place?Scott Bauman is mere days away from either finding relief or ending it all. In a deadend job the odds are stacked against him. But Bauman isn t your average, everyday ordinary dude. He s special .Author of the bestselling Leaves Piled High, Douglas Robbins breathes life into the world of Scott Bauman. With fascinating characters and humorous depictions, Robbins weaves an engaging story that absorbs the reader with his sharp wit and insight.The Reluctant Human dives into what it means to truly live a meaningful existence.Review (Bauman)...is a latter day Holden Caulfield, but with real cajones. Walter Barnett A story for our time. Sad, funny, and inspiring. Stephen BorsakFrom the AuthorThere had always been a calling. When down and out, depressed and angry, I still heard that sacred voice calling from my dreams. I wrote The Reluctant Human as a protest against daily routines that grind us all up.I wanted to reach people who ve had similar experiences and who ve always wanted more. I felt that writing was the only way to say what I needed to say: that if we can change, the world can too.I don t want the main character, Scott, to suffer, as I don t want to suffer myself, but in The Reluctant Human he must suffer to reach a conclusion to throw it all down. Not to say we can eliminate suffering, but by going down the wrong roads we are guaranteed pain.This is the first in a series of three books. The Reluctant Human is about dark struggles we endure and the voice that calls up from the soul. The second book is The Emerging Human. It s about people reclaiming life and how we can affect others. The third is The Human Remains where people influence the world and impact the future in ways we have all envisioned yet perhaps never experienced.About the AuthorDouglas Robbins began his writing career in school after a teacher asked the class to write a poem. In that moment he found a power in words that he had never found anywhere else.Douglas grew up, attended college, and held numerous jobs from sales to construction to insurance. The jobs changed but his need to write remained a constant. According to Robbins, As time passed along I started writing more seriously because it was the only profession that ever made sense to me. It wasn t so much a career move, it was a move out of necessity. Robbins released his first full length novel, The Reluctant Human in June 2012. He quickly followed that up with the novella, Max Johnny, and a book of short stories, Leaves Piled HighRobbins is currently working on the sequels to The Reluctant Human as well as an upcoming novella entitled, Maine.Robbins lives in the Greater New York city area with his fianc. He enjoys riding his motorcycle Red as often as possible and practicing the martial arts.
